NACOC arrest firearm and drugs dealer in Kundugu
Share on FacebookShare on XShare on WhatsApp

The Upper West Regional Command of the Narcotics Control Commission (NACOC) has arrested a 60-year-old man, Abass Seidu, for allegedly dealing in ammunition and illicit drugs at Kundugu in the Wa East District.

According to a statement posted on NACOC’s Facebook page on Thursday, February 19, the suspect was apprehended on January 29, 2026, following a series of surveillance operations conducted by undercover officers at the Kundugu market and at his stash house in Wa.

During the initial arrest, operatives reportedly recovered three cartons of ammunition and quantities of tramadol concealed among assorted pharmaceutical products.

A subsequent search at Seidu’s stash house located at the Wa-Kejetia lorry station led to the discovery of seven additional cartons and 362 individual pieces of ammunition, as well as assorted foreign cigarettes. In total, authorities seized 2,626 cartridges of ammunition.

NACOC indicated that investigations suggest the suspect had been supplying both local clients and individuals from neighbouring Burkina Faso.

Seidu has since been handed over to the Wa Municipal Police for further investigations and prosecution.

The Upper West Regional Command cautioned the public against engaging in criminal activities and urged citizens to cooperate with law enforcement agencies in the fight against drug trafficking and illegal arms trade.
